CINCINNATI (AP) - A woman charged with murder in the death of her 2-year-old girl who weighed 13 pounds when she died of starvation and blunt-force injury has rejected a plea deal in southwest Ohio.
Twenty-nine-year-old Andrea Bradley told a judge in Cincinnati on Wednesday that she wouldn’t accept a deal from prosecutors to change her plea in exchange for removing the death sentence possibility she could face if convicted at trial. She has pleaded not guilty to charges including aggravated murder in the March 2015 death of Glenara Bates.
Bradley’s attorney, William Welsh, said Bradley felt it was in her best interest to not accept the deal and go forward.
Glenara’s father pleaded not guilty to the same charges.
Authorities say Glenara was badly beaten and had bite marks and other injuries.
